Wells Fargo Near Me

How much you can take out in a day at Wells Fargo ATMs differs between customers. To find out your personal limit, you can log into your online account, call the number on the back of your debit card, visit a local Wells Fargo branch or look up your limit on the original paperwork you got when you opened your account.


How To Find The Best Home Remodeling Contractors Near Me

The word "remodeling" is often used interchangeably with "renovating," but the former usually involves some sort of structural change to your home, such as constructing or taking down walls. Your DIY skills might be fine for smaller household projects, but here are some services that you'll likely want to leave in the very able hands of the pros:

Remodeling a Kitchen or Bathroom

Kitchen and bathroom remodels regularly make the wish lists of many homeowners, and they're also a hit with home buyers. As these rooms involve intricate plumbing and electrical work as well as installing major appliances, it's best to hire a remodeling team to do the work.

Constructing a New Room or Floor

Many homeowners love their current space, but they want more of it. With an increase in multigenerational households as well as more people working and studying from home, building an additional room or an entire floor becomes a necessity. A general contractor and a team of subcontractors can easily take on this project, which can take weeks or even months depending on the design and the size of the space.

Finishing a Basement

A finished basement allows for additional living space for members of the household or perhaps even an income-generating basement apartment, provided the work is done up to code. Either way, the lowest level of a home need not remain a dank, dark dungeon relegated only for storage and laundry.

Building an Accessory Dwelling Unit (ADU)

Accessory dwelling units (ADU) are one way to add additional space to a home, such as an apartment over the garage or an in-law suite/guest house in the backyard. Like with a basement apartment conversion, this is an extensive construction process that must be in compliance with all local building codes, or it could land a homeowner in a heap of trouble.

Good news: There are plenty of home remodelers who have plenty of experience adding ADUs to homes and they'd be more than willing to navigate the permit process for you.

Exterior Remodel

Curb appeal is more than just a tidy lawn and garden. A well-maintained exterior also contributes to your property's great first impression, and it protects the interior of your home as well. While a roof replacement might seem like an expensive and extensive undertaking, it could pay off handsomely at resale. According to Remodeling's 2021 Cost vs. Value Report, replacing the asphalt shingles on your roof could recoup more than 60% at resale, while replacing the bottom third of your home's front-facing siding with manufactured stone veneer could see 92.1% return on investment. Exterior work involves heavy tools and high ladders, so unless you are an advanced DIYer, it's best to leave this work up to the pros.

How To Find The Best HVAC Services Near You

If you type "Best HVAC Near me" into the search bar, you may get back a wide array of HVAC technicians who cover a range of duties—from electrical to mechanical functions. HVAC contractors are technicians who have years of formal training in this specialized trade. Some are pros with air conditioning in residential homes, while others might be best at refrigeration units for commercial properties. To know how to choose among them, you'll have to narrow down the service you need. Here are the top three:

Installation

If your HVAC is on the fritz, look for a tech who can identify the kind of unit that would be ideal for your home and who can quickly install it. They disconnect the current system and dispose of the old materials while connecting a new unit. They run checks for sound and safety, before giving your unit a clean bill of health.

Routine Maintenance

This can include cleaning ductwork, changing air filters, inspecting pipes for leakage and checking thermostats and electric circuits. During routine maintenance, HVAC techs also assess the refrigerant levels and refill, if needed. Most homes need servicing annually. Yet, if you have allergies or share ductwork and walls with neighbors, it may be worthwhile to have your filters and ducts cleaned more frequently.

Repairs

HVAC technicians can also repair failing parts of the unit and replace malfunctioning systems. This type of request often comes on short notice and odd hours. These emergency visits may be billed at a much higher rate. Also, technicians usually have to come back another day, when replacement parts and devices have arrive from vendors and manufacturers. Always check your warranty to see if the labor or parts could be reimbursed by the manufacturer.
